Nmap Development mailing list archives

Error openssl nse_nsock_get_ssl


From: Flyers <flyers () caramail com>
Date: Wed, 04 Apr 2012 11:13:17 +0200

Hi,

I was trying to compile nmap with ssl support.
After installing libssl using : apt-get install libssl-dev

I got this error while compiling nmap 5.61TEST5 :

g++ -Wl,-E  -Lnbase -Lnsock/src/   -o nmap main.o nmap.o targets.o
tcpip.o nmap_error.o utils.o idle_scan.o osscan.o osscan2.o FPEngine.o
FPModel.o output.o payload.o scan_engine.o timing.o charpool.o
services.o protocols.o nmap_rpc.o portlist.o NmapOps.o TargetGroup.o
Target.o FingerPrintResults.o service_scan.o NmapOutputTable.o
MACLookup.o nmap_tty.o nmap_dns.o  traceroute.o portreasons.o xml.o
nse_main.o nse_utility.o nse_nsock.o nse_dnet.o nse_fs.o nse_nmaplib.o
nse_debug.o nse_pcrelib.o nse_binlib.o nse_bit.o nse_openssl.o
nse_ssl_cert.o  -lnbase -lnsock libpcre/libpcre.a libpcap/libpcap.a
-lssl -lcrypto libnetutil/libnetutil.a
./libdnet-stripped/src/.libs/libdnet.a ./liblua/liblua.a
./liblinear/liblinear.a -ldl
nse_ssl_cert.o: In function `l_get_ssl_certificate(lua_State*)':
/home/user/nmap-5.61TEST5/nse_ssl_cert.cc:400: multiple definition of
`l_get_ssl_certificate(lua_State*)'
nse_nsock.o:nse_nsock.cc:(.text+0x2029): first defined here
nse_ssl_cert.o: In function `l_get_ssl_certificate(lua_State*)':
nse_ssl_cert.cc:(.text+0x71f): undefined reference to
`nse_nsock_get_ssl(lua_State*)'
collect2: ld a retourné 1 code d'état d'exécution
make[1]: *** [nmap] Erreur 1
make[1]: quittant le répertoire « /home/user/nmap-5.61TEST5 »
make: *** [all] Erreur 2

Seems like i'm the only one who got this error ...
_______________________________________________
Sent through the nmap-dev mailing list
http://cgi.insecure.org/mailman/listinfo/nmap-dev
Archived at http://seclists.org/nmap-dev/


Current thread: